Pregnancy and Yoga: The Ideal Tandem by:James Pendergraft

Because yoga has long been an ancient tradition of promoting holistic health

, practicing this while you are pregnant is one of the healthiest ways to maintain good health and well-being. Yoga is very effective in relieving stress, achieving flexibility and lessening the discomforts associated with pregnancy. It also aids in preparing a woman's body for the impending date of childbirth.

If you are pregnant, then you have to be aware that this is a time for you to fully nurture your body and sense of well-being. This is because you would also have to think about the baby inside your womb feeling everything that you are feeling.

The fetus will be able to feel all the effects of the stress and tension that you could possibly feel during your pregnancy. As such, it is very essential that you make an effort to be relaxed always. Yoga will help you with this, especially with the different poses recommended for women that will bring in a serene mind state. This will contribute to the good overall health of both you and your baby.

Yoga consists of five essential tools that are very helpful in maintaining a perfectly healthy and safe pregnancy. If you will observe all of them, then you will see how well pregnancy and yoga works with each other.

These are the five tools of yoga that you should know about if you want to have a smooth pregnancy:

1)Meditation. This is a therapeutic tool that will aid in resolving the fears, neuroses, and conflicts that are usually present during pregnancy. This will also help in bringing excellent awareness that will help you form a connection between yourself and the child in your womb.

2)Yoga Exercises. These will work gently on your pelvis and your reproductive organs so that a considerably easy childbirth can be achieved. These will also help in ensuring that the fetus developing inside your body is supplied optimally with the nutrients and blood it needs.

3)Deep Relaxation. This is very effective in initiating mental and physical relaxation during pregnancy as well as during your preparation for childbirth.

4)Mudras and Bandhas. These stimulations brought on by these locks and gestures have powerful psychological and physical effects on your reproductive organs.

5)Pranayama or Breathing. This is a powerful method that ensures the sufficient oxygen supply as well as an excellent life force for both you and the child in your womb. This is very effective for maintaining your fitness during your entire pregnancy.

Now that you know the five yoga tools that you can make use of to have a fulfilling pregnancy instead of one fraught with problems and discomforts, it is best to decide as soon as possible to utilize them. This is because yoga will not only bring great effects for you but also for the bundle of joy that is growing inside of you. The mental and physical development of your baby could best be enhanced by practicing yoga along with other healthy habits needed during pregnancy.
